OSGi R4 Http Service and Web Container (RFC66) implementation using Jetty 8.




OSGi R4 Http Service and Web Applications (OSGi Enterprise Release chapter 128) implementation using Jetty 8.

Pax Web facilitates an easy installation of WAR bundles as well as discovery of web elements published as OSGi services. All of this beside the, standard, programmatic registration as detailed in the HTTP Service specs.

Right now following Technologies are supported by Pax Web:

Pax Web 7.x:

  • Servlet 3.1.0
  • JSP 2.3.1
  • JSF 2.2.12
  • Jetty 9.4.x
  • Tomcat 8.x
  • support of CDI (through Pax-CDI)
  • Web-Fragments

Pax Web 4.x:

  • Servlet 3.0
  • JSP 2.0
  • JSF 2.1
  • Jetty 9.0.x
  • Tomcat 7.x (still experimental, but better supported)
  • support of CDI (through Pax-CDI)
  • support of only Servlet 3.0 annotated Servlets in JAR
  • Web-Fragments

Pax Web 3.x:

  • Servlet 3.0
  • JSP 1.1.2
  • JSF 2.1
  • Jetty 8.x
  • Tomcat 7.x (still experimental)
  • support of CDI (through Pax-CDI)
  • support of only Servlet 3.0 annotated Servlets in JAR

Pax Web 2.x:

  • Servlet 3.0
  • JSP 1.1.2
  • JSF 2.1
  • Jetty 8.x
  • support of application binding to a virtual host (Http-Connector) for WABs

Pax Web 1.x:

  • Servlet 2.5
  • JSP 1.1.2
  • JSF 1.2
  • Jetty 7.x
